Title :
Feedback Control Analysis of Microwave Oscillator Stabilization with a Transmission Cavity

Abstract :
This paper shows cavity stabilization of microwave oscillators can be characterized by a Type O (AFC) servomechanism. Stabilized phase noise spectral density can now be analyzed as a function of modulation rate. Measured phase noise data of stabilized IMPATT and Gunn oscillators are compared with the new theory.
